This report presents a Sustainable Asset Valuation (SAVi) of the Poçem and Kalivaç hydropower projects on the Vjosa River in Albania, concluding that these assets generate higher costs to the state, environment, and communities than they provide in benefits.

  • The SAVi assessment concludes that the Poçem and Kalivaç hydropower projects are not a preferable electricity generation solution for Albania because their generated benefits are outweighed by tax losses, societal burdens, and lifetime costs. The report suggests that solar photovoltaic is a more viable and beneficial alternative for producing a similar amount of electricity.
  • Cost-benefit analyses for the two projects on the Vjosa River resulted in negative values: negative EUR 233 million for Poçem and negative EUR 321 million for Kalivaç. These results stem from adverse effects on ecosystems, communities, and economic sectors including tourism and agriculture.
  • Integrating valued externalities increases the levelized cost of electricity (LCOE) for both projects. For Poçem, the cost rises from a conventional EUR 121 per MWh to EUR 184 per MWh; for Kalivaç, it rises from almost EUR 158 per MWh to EUR 203 per MWh. These costs increase further if climate change risks materialize.
  • Financial analysis indicates the projects are not financially attractive based on domestic market electricity offtake prices. The project internal rate of return (IRR) is 9.32% in a conventional scenario, which is below the 13.5% hurdle rate. The IRR falls to 3.15% when sediment dredging costs are included and becomes negative if externalities are internalized.
